Output 8dc8d8ab6831b567e6fa2a2e02f5b844b6a1d3f53bb7063aeb0fdbea046ce35a:13

value
378590
script pubkey
OP_0 OP_PUSHBYTES_20 df1e0fc7f4d97a7e680ca9cc78fec35f153ee8f7
address
bc1qmu0ql3l5m9a8u6qv48x83lkrtu2na68hgjhw8f
transaction
8dc8d8ab6831b567e6fa2a2e02f5b844b6a1d3f53bb7063aeb0fdbea046ce35a
confirmations
258383
spent
true